Background



Previous research has shown that increased concentration of TMAO may promote atherosclerosis and increase risk for cardiovascular disease. TMAO is produced by bacteria from the precursors choline and carnitine. Dr. Steve Hazen is a world recognized physician scientist who made some of the first discoveries linking TMAO with increased risk of cardiovascular disease, with the development of analytical methods to measure these compounds, and with investigating foods, such as meats, and how their consumption might impact disease risk.





Requirements



Analysis of serum samples from the USDA Meat And Pattern (MAP) Study to measure the concentration of serum choline, carnitine, trimethylamine N-oxide (TMAO) and related compounds of endogenous and microbial carnitine and choline metabolism.



Analyze 270 human serum samples for carnitine, choline, betaine and TMAO using LC/MS/MS methods. Analytical approach must use stable isotope dilution liquid chromatography with online LC–MS/MS on a triple quadrupole mass spectrometer. A stable isotope, such as d9(trimethyl)TMAO, should be used as an internal standard.



TMAO, related compounds, and d9(trimethyl)TMAO should be monitored using electrospray ionization in positive‐ion mode with multiple reaction monitoring of parent and characteristic daughter ion transitions: m/z 76→58 and 85→66, respectively.
